The COP29 climate summit in Baku has reached a pivotal juncture as delegates struggle to finalize a new global finance target. Developing countries are advocating for an increase in annual funding to over $1 trillion to address climate-driven disasters and energy transitions. Conversely, several developed nations have expressed caution, emphasizing the need for private sector involvement and suggesting that wealthier emerging economies should also contribute to the fund. Reports indicate that while a draft text has been circulated, key figures regarding the total financial commitment remain bracketed. Analysts suggest that the outcome of these talks will be a defining moment for international climate policy, though significant divisions over responsibility and scale persist.
